Output e73a1c5099811ded60ef850cdc750331b4a5466c1c824cb8698a34d8dd61e758:204

value
116883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c2d4d19b522ff4ee2cb6e8cba215da593e4054 OP_EQUAL
address
3Lzhu8wGsAmn6e7fAX4PHRGhSzzvYhZVs5
transaction
e73a1c5099811ded60ef850cdc750331b4a5466c1c824cb8698a34d8dd61e758
spent
true